Output 3c16a5f45c838452c1971ada699705eb9ef154543f118256c5d72619ace06593:0

value
885230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48b8a544a74e783a182196765b212759cd233296 OP_EQUALVERIFY OP_CHECKSIG
address
17dWrDGZJkeHQQMUxqeBK9NuDasUocAe9i
transaction
3c16a5f45c838452c1971ada699705eb9ef154543f118256c5d72619ace06593
confirmations
457744
spent
true